Engineering & Applied Physics is the 448th most popular major in the country with 994 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across the Plains States region, there were 33 engineering and applied physics gra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

For this year’s “Schools Highly Focused on Applied Physics Major in the Plains States Region” ranking, we looked at 13 colleges that offer a degree in engineering and applied physics.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in engineering and applied physics.
